  • Patent number: 4737061
    Abstract: A mobile bucket mechanism for collection and conveyance of a bulk material which includes buckets carried by chains over generally vertically arranged sheaves, a support structure for the sheaves which drives the chains to move the buckets in a path to collect bulk material located at a lower end of the path. A feeding device is driven by the support structure to cut into the bulk material and feed the bulk material to the buckets. The feeding device includes a stationary, jacket-like cylindrical body surrounding the path of the buckets and the lower portion of the supporting structure. The cylindrical body has an opening adjacent a portion of the path along which the buckets are carried upward by the chains. A cutting head surrounds the cylindrical body and has essentially radially oriented blades rotatable with respect to the cylindrical body so as to supply the bulk material to the opening.
